Ludhiana, Jan. 15 -- A Lohri celebration in the Tibba area took a violent turn on Tuesday night after a heated argument between a local resident and a biker escalated into a firing incident in New Rishi Nagar. A 32-year-old man sustained two bullet injuries and was rushed to a private hospital, where his condition is stated to be stable.

The injured has been identified as Ankit Bhalla, a resident of Sant Vihar on Noorwala Road. He had gone to the Tibba area to celebrate Lohri at a relative's house when the incident occurred.
